EI

Emily Ip

Engineering Manager at Curve

Engineering Manager Manager
e***@imaginecurve.com Sign up
Pro only
Pro only
Pro only
London, England, United Kingdom

Company Details

Company: Curve
Industry: financial services
Employees: 350
Revenue: 60000000
Funding: 1312826970
HQ Location: England, United Kingdom
Company LinkedIn: Pro only
Manager level · Engineering Manager